  • the invention relates to an artificial insemination catheter Insemination, in particular of pigs, consisting of a thermoplastic Material of existing catheter tube with longitudinal tube channel, that has a molded body made of soft compressible at its distal end Carries material that surrounds the pipe end and one that continues the pipe channel Molded body channel contains.
  • Such insemination catheters are known for example from EP 0 605 406 B1 or the corresponding DE 691 30 835 T2 known.
  • the molded body is here a tampon made of soft foam
  • the molded body channel in the extension of the pipe channel has a narrowing zone, which has the purpose with a force pressing on the molded body at the front, namely by the pressure of the organs during penetration into the animal's vagina.
  • Side effect is that the front edge of the semi-hard material existing pipe is prevented by the pressure applied from behind to move to the front opening of the molded body and then the animal to irritate by scratching and scraping the tissue in an unfavorable sense.
  • the constriction of the molding channel proves at the time of desired passage of the liquid as unfavorable, in addition, the The relevant shape is not in the public domain.
  • the invention is intended to inseminate a catheter of the type mentioned be further developed in that without the need for a constriction of the canal the emergence of the sharp-edged pipe end is avoided.
  • the pipe end in the molded body with projecting beyond the pipe outer diameter, firmly parts sitting on the pipe, in particular integral parts of the pipe the are preferably produced by deforming the pipe end, is anchored.
  • a conical widening of the pipe end is possible, however is also a splicing and outward bending of the resulting individual strip-shaped webs possible.
  • the corresponding deformations The thermoplastic pipe material can easily be heated when the pipe tip is heated and the material remains when it cools down permanently in the projecting position. That in the pointed process or another molding process applied material of the molded body encloses the protruding parts. Unless it is the foremost parts of the pipe, they cannot be pushed forward in the channel or by pushing back the soft front parts of the molded body finally in its end face get.
  • protruding parts consists of, for example shrunk or welded onto the outside of the pipe in the area of the pipe end Ring body, the - right at the end of the tube or something from this moved away - protrudes radially outwards and relative to the pipe in the longitudinal direction is fixed, so that the integral molded body formed around it is also fixed relative to the tube in the longitudinal direction.
  • a pig insemination catheter is in accordance with the embodiment of FIG Fig. 1 from an approximately 50 cm long tube 1 made of a relatively rigid thermoplastic Material with a distal end 2, on the enlarged diameter a molded body 3 made of a resilient foam sits.
  • the tube has a tube channel 4 and the molded body 3 has a molded body channel 5 on.
  • Part of the pipe 1 is seated in the molded-body duct 5, and part, namely beyond the end of the pipe, channel 5 represents the straight-line continuation of the Pipe channel 4 is.
  • the Pipe inserted into a mold cavity that has a core for the channel 5 and then introducing foaming material into the mold cavity fills up and sits firmly on the tube 1 inside.
  • the tube 1 has a conical widening at its distal end 10, which makes the pipe end funnel-shaped.
  • the widening 10 holds completely within the volume of the molded body 3, and the material of the Shaped body 3 rests on the widening 10 on both sides, that is to say still on the inside with an annular lip area 11, which is between the expansion 10 and the Channel 5 is.
  • the wall of the channel 5 is in the extension of the Cylinder outer surface of the tube 1, so the channel 5 has a wall thickness of the pipe has a larger radius than the pipe duct 4.
  • FIG. 2 is a similar embodiment in a comparable representation shown, but with the wall of the channel 5 in the extension of the inner tube wall lies and the channel 5 has the same diameter as the pipe channel 4.
  • the ring lip region 11 turns out somewhat stronger here.
  • dashed In Fig. 2 a circumferential bead 12 is drawn in the channel 5, which, if Desired can be formed on the wall of the channel 5 to the channel 5th relatively easy to close by external pressure in a manner known per se.
  • FIG. 3 shows a perspective view of the tube 1 with the widening 10 at the distal end 2 according to the embodiments of Fig.n 1 and 2. This Shaping is done by pushing on the pipe end when heated created a suitable cone.
  • Fig. 4 shows a different shape of the distal end 2, on which in this case the tube is spliced into a number of strips 15 which are bent outwards and are permanently deformed.
  • This claw-like shape is particularly suitable for tube materials that are thinning due to the conical expansion tolerated less.
  • the cross section through the end of the catheter can also be look like in Fig. 2.
  • Fig. 5 shows the anchoring of the tube 1 in the molded body 3 by a Area of the pipe end on this immovably mounted ring 17, the is melted, for example.
  • the Prevents pipe 1 in the molded body 3 is pushing the Prevents pipe 1 in the molded body 3, however, the push back and Fold back the front end of the molded body 3 so that the sharp-edged Tube end comes out, less effectively prevented.
  • This version is suitable mainly for constructions with a somewhat firmer molded body 3.
